BEARTOOTH CONSTRUCTION
2221 26TH. STREET, CODY, WY 82414
BEARTOOTH CONSTRUCTION has had 1 OSHA inspection since May 29, 1993, resulting in 8 violations and $2,000 in penalties on record.
As reported in the U.S. Department of Labor OSHA enforcement database. Having inspection records is common for businesses in regulated industries. Penalty amounts may differ from final amounts after settlement or judicial review.
- Public records show the most recent OSHA inspection at this establishment began on May 29, 1993. That inspection has since been closed.
- The violation record includes 8 Serious citations out of 8 total (100%).
- No willful violations have been recorded at this location.
- No repeat violations appear in the inspection history for this establishment.
- All inspections at this establishment have been closed.
